Understanding the Soccer Schedule
Soccer schedules can vary significantly based on the league, country, and time of year. Here’s a breakdown of how to navigate the sometimescomplicated world of soccer scheduling:
Each major league has a structured schedule that usually runs for several months. For example, the English Premier League (EPL) typically runs from August to May. During this period, teams play each other multiple times, and the schedule is published well in advance. Check the league's official website or trusted sports news platforms to see the upcoming fixtures.
Example: The EPL fixture list can be found on the official Premier League website, making it easy for fans to keep track of game days.
International fixtures, including qualifiers for tournaments like the FIFA World Cup or UEFA European Championship, follow a different schedule and often include friendly matches. These fixtures are typically announced a year or more in advance.

Example: FIFA maintains an updated schedule for all national teams, allowing fans to know when their country’s team is competing.
Local clubs and amateur leagues often have less predictable schedules. To find out if there’s a match today, check local club websites or community sports pages.
Example: Many community soccer clubs provide updates through their social media pages or local news outlets, which can be essential for local fans wishing to attend.
In today’s digital age, there are numerous apps available that can provide realtime information about soccer matches worldwide. Apps such as LiveScore, ESPN, or the official leagues’ apps offer notifications for matches, scores, and other updates.
Practical Tip: Downloading one of these apps can ensure you never miss a match. You can customize notifications to get alerted about your favorite teams or leagues.
Given the popularity of soccer, many matches are broadcast live on television or via streaming services. Knowing when and where to watch can enhance your viewing experience.
Example: Services like ESPN+, Peacock, or Disney+ often carry matches, but you need to verify which specific games are being aired today.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How can I know if a specific match is being broadcast today?
A: The best way to confirm if a match is being broadcast is to check your local listings through television providers or streaming services. Websites like ESPN or the official league websites often provide broadcast schedules and times for specific matches.
Q: Are there any free ways to watch soccer matches online?
A: Yes, while many matches require subscriptions, some platforms may offer free trials or free matches. Websites like YouTube may occasionally stream games, especially during significant tournaments.
Q: What if I miss a match? How can I catch up?
A: If you miss a live match, platforms like BBC iPlayer or ESPN+ may offer match highlights. Additionally, many sports news websites provide match summaries and analysis shortly after the game ends.
Q: How can I find local matches to attend?
A: Local clubs generally display their match schedules on their official social media pages or community boards. Websites like Meetup or Eventbrite can also feature local soccer games worth attending.
Q: Are international fixtures scheduled the same way as domestic leagues?
A: No, international fixtures, especially qualifiers and friendlies, follow a different model and are usually scheduled long in advance. FIFA and continental football associations provide their schedules ahead of time.
Q: What should I do if I attend a match in person?
A: Attending a match offers a unique experience. Arrive early to soak in the atmosphere, understand stadium protocols, and engage with fellow fans. Remember to check the club's COVID protocols, if applicable.
